    A poker run is an organized event in which participants, usually using motorcycles, all-terrain vehicles, boats, snowmobiles, horses, on foot or other means of transportation, must visit five to seven checkpoints, drawing a playing card at each one.

    Brag is an 18th century British card game, and the British national representative of the vying or "bluffing" family of gambling games. [1] It is a descendant of the Elizabethan game of Primero [2] and one of the several ancestors to poker, the modern version just varying in betting style and hand rankings.

    The card game of poker has many variations, most of which were created in the United States in the mid-1800s through the early 1900s. The standard order of play applies to most of these games, but to fully specify a poker game requires details about which hand values are used, the number of betting rounds, and exactly what cards are dealt and what other actions are taken between rounds.
